PlainPrivacy does not decide what the law requires your policy to say. We establish the technical facts behind the website and flag mismatches between the published documentation and the implementation we can observe.
Identify analytics, advertising, CMP and other third-party technologies present in the tested website journeys.
Document observed cookies and browser storage and compare them with the site’s current disclosures.
Record third-party domains and visible network activity that can help identify vendors receiving browser-side data.
Verify what happens before a choice, after accept/reject and when consent is later changed.
Where relevant, document technical differences in regional banners, opt-outs and consent behavior.
Highlight technologies or behaviors observed on the site that are missing, stale or inconsistent in current cookie/privacy documentation.

How it works
The initial review establishes the current behavior. Recommended changes are then scoped, implemented only when agreed, and retested afterward.
Confirm the platforms, regions, consent system and tracking stack that need to be tested.
Run controlled browser journeys and inspect consent, storage, requests and tracking behavior.
Separate working controls from technical issues and identify the fixes that matter most.
When implementation support is requested, apply agreed changes and repeat the relevant tests.
